CBA Elementary Crew

CBA has three Expected Student Outcomes (ESO’s). We desire our students to become men and women of character who are 1) creative thinkers, 2) confident communicators, and 3) courageous leaders. National Hispanic Heritage Month

You may have noticed that some of our teachers are donning beuatiful clothing from their home countries.  This is in celebration of National Hispanic Heritage Month and we invite you to join in the celebration!
